As the heated race for the White House enters the home stretch, former Vice President Joe Biden and Democrats are vastly outspending President Donald Trump and Republicans on television and radio ad spending -- by more than $85 million in the final three weeks.

But while the Biden campaign itself is spending more than the Trump campaign, pro-Biden outside groups are the ones driving the drastic gap in the ad war between the two presidential candidates. In contrast, pro-Trump outside efforts, headed by America First Action, a super PAC endorsed by the president, and Preserve America, a new super PAC backed by major GOP donors, only have $27 million booked on television and radio time in the final three weeks.
